Emotional Intelligence During the Holidays

December 10, 2025 @ 1:00 pm 2:00 pm CST

The holidays heighten emotions in both positive and negative ways. From joy to sadness, learn how to understand and navigate your emotions and the bah-humbugs of others.

This program will provide a basic overview of emotional intelligence and give you 12 easy tips to use during the holidays that help reduce stress, anxiety, depression, loneliness, and feeling overwhelmed.

Who will Benefit from this Program:

All Library Personnel – from full-time to volunteers
